Executive Administrative Assistant to the Chief Financial Officer
THDA
Job Summary
Provides administrative support to the Chief Financial Officer (CFO) as well as various other agency duties such as, but not limited to, payment card coordination, agency motor vehicle upkeep, answering a multi-line phone, and agency mail coordination.
Job Responsibilities
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
Essential duties and responsibilities include the following. Other duties may be assigned.
- Provides administrative support to the Chief Financial Officer (CFO)
- Serves as THDA Payment Card Coordinator, ensuring that payment card use throughout THDA complies with policies and procedures established by Tennessee’s Department of Finance and Administration (F&A).
- Answers multi-line telephone system determines caller’s needs and routes to the appropriate person and promptly retrieves and forwards messages from the answering machine and the toll-free line.
- Processes mail including overnight special delivery mail, metered mail machine, and courier requests

- Forwards facsimile e-mails to appropriate recipients in a timely manner.
- Stays knowledgeable of all Agency programs to direct inquiries accurately.
- Performs all agency-wide duties associated with MVM.
- Performs all duties surrounding agency employee parking
- Performs in-office support such as visitor retrieval, courier requests
- Orders and distributes agency breakroom and copier supplies.
- Maintains and updates resource information to use when responding to caller or visitor inquiries.
- Assists with Agency Grant Purchase Orders when necessary
- Performs other duties as assigned
Qualifications
MINIMUM
The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ge, skills, and/or abilities required.
Education and Experience:
- High school diploma or equivalent GED plus post-high school coursework or relevant certifications.
- Four years of related experience as an administrative assistant or equivalent.
- Minimum of two years of successful receptionist experience and/or call center experience preferred.
The above qualifications express the minimum standards of education and/or experience for this position. Other combinations of education and experience, if evaluated as equivalent, may be taken into consideration.
